Intel ‘Women and the Web’ Study | Full Report

Intel’s ground-breaking report on “Women and the Web,” unveiling concrete data on the enormous Internet gender gap in the developing world and the social and economic benefits of securing Internet access for women.
GlobeScan in partnership with Dalberg, designed and conducted 1,800 face-to-face and 400 online surveys amongst women and girls in Uganda, India, Mexico and Egypt. The resulting report uncovers barriers for Internet access in the developing world, identifies tools to help increase access and provides an understanding for how women in developing countries currently using the Internet and how they are benefitting.
